Gretchen Hancocks Paintings

Tuesday, March 27, 2018. White Mums on Teal and Lavender. Chrysanthemums from the grocery store, available just before the spring flowers are out in my yard. I set up the still life with a bright overhead light and threw the background into shadow for strong contrast. I like the purple shadows on the tabletop and in the flowers. I also like contrast between the tight and loose edges in the flower petals.
